Exemple #1
0
function isola_dequeue_fonts()
{
    if (class_exists('TypekitData') && class_exists('CustomDesign') && CustomDesign::is_upgrade_active()) {
        $customfonts = TypekitData::get('families');
        if ($customfonts && $customfonts['site-title']['id'] && $customfonts['headings']['id'] && $customfonts['body-text']['id']) {
            wp_dequeue_style('isola-source-sans-pro');
        }
    }
}
Exemple #2
0
/**
 * De-queue Google fonts if custom fonts are being used instead.
 */
function pique_dequeue_fonts()
{
    if (class_exists('TypekitData') && class_exists('CustomDesign') && CustomDesign::is_upgrade_active()) {
        $customfonts = TypekitData::get('families');
        if ($customfonts['headings']['id'] && $customfonts['body-text']['id']) {
            wp_dequeue_style('pique-fonts');
        }
    }
}
Exemple #3
0
/**
 * Dequeue font styles when Typekit is active.
 *
 * We don't want to enqueue the font scripts if the blog
 * has WP.com Custom Design and is using a 'Headings' font.
 */
function bouquet_dequeue_fonts()
{
    if (class_exists('TypekitData') && class_exists('CustomDesign') && CustomDesign::is_upgrade_active()) {
        $customfonts = TypekitData::get('families');
        if ($customfonts && $customfonts['headings']['id']) {
            wp_dequeue_style('sorts mill goudy');
        }
    }
}
Exemple #4
0
function sundance_dequeue_fonts()
{
    if (class_exists('TypekitData') && class_exists('CustomDesign')) {
        if (CustomDesign::is_upgrade_active()) {
            $customfonts = TypekitData::get('families');
            if (!$customfonts) {
                return;
            }
            $site_title = $customfonts['site-title'];
            $headings = $customfonts['headings'];
            if ($site_title['id'] && $headings['id']) {
                wp_dequeue_style('sundance-droid-serif');
            }
        }
    }
}
Exemple #5
0
/**
 * Dequeue Google Fonts if Custom Fonts are being used instead.
 *
 * @package    Mayer/inc
 * @since      1.0.0
 */
function mayer_dequeue_fonts()
{
    if (class_exists('TypekitData') && class_exists('CustomDesign') && CustomDesign::is_upgrade_active()) {
        $custom_fonts = TypekitData::get('families');
        if ($custom_fonts && $custom_fonts['headings']['id']) {
            wp_dequeue_style('mayer-nunito');
            wp_dequeue_style('mayer-muli');
            wp_dequeue_style('mayer-source-sans-pro');
        }
        if ($custom_fonts && $custom_fonts['body-text']['id']) {
            wp_dequeue_style('mayer-nunito');
            wp_dequeue_style('mayer-muli');
            wp_dequeue_style('mayer-source-sans-pro');
        }
    }
}